A significant traffic incident occurred today on Interstate 580 West near Dougherty Road Off-Ramp in Dublin, CA, resulting in notable traffic disruptions during the morning commute. The collision involved two vehicles: a dark-colored sedan that struck a right-side wall and a blue Subaru Legacy, which was reported to be on fire.
Emergency services, including the California Highway Patrol and fire responders, quickly arrived at the scene to manage the situation. The presence of hazardous conditions on the right shoulder led to lane closures, causing traffic delays and congestion in the area. Motorists are advised to expect backups as responders work to secure the scene and clear the vehicles involved.
The Subaru Legacy was confirmed to be on fire, prompting immediate action from fire crews to extinguish the flames. The dark-colored sedan remained on the roadway, further complicating traffic flow.
